what causes the appearance of lines in an emission spectrum?\nlight is absorbed as an electron moves to a higher energy state.\nlight is released as an electron moves to a lower energy state.\nan electron is released as light when it moves to a lower energy state.\nan electron is released as light when it moves to a higher energy state.

Answer

Brief Explanations:

In an atom, electrons can occupy different energy - levels. When an electron moves from a higher energy state to a lower energy state, it releases energy in the form of light. This emitted light has specific wavelengths corresponding to the energy difference between the two states, creating the lines in an emission spectrum.

Answer:

Light is released as an electron moves to a lower energy state.
